I just sailed on the Sept. 25 Carnival Miracle and took the Soto's Sting Ray Tour. It was very disappointing as the driver of the van stayed in the van and did not help my 72 year old mother in law out of the van. The guides were more interested in taking their pictures (to sell at the end of the tour) than providing the service I was requesting. On one occassion, I asked one guide to take a picture of my wife and I as we interacted with a sting ray and he proceded to take a picture from his camera first.

Another couple on this tour told me at the end of the tour, they thought two snorkeling stops were to be made and we made only one.

I took this same Soto tour two years ago and completely enjoyed it (we did make two snorkeling stops then) and the guides were totaly involved in the snorkeling and with the sting rays with the people on the tour. Unfortunately, on this last tour they were not. I would not recommend using Soto. Also, the other couple said that they enjoyed Marvin's alot more than Soto's.
